I’m afraid the best you’d be able to do is to take in extra carbohydrate prior to physical activity in the hope that this would keep your blood glucose levels where they belong. It may also pay you to test your blood glucose levels several times during your period of physical activity just to make sure that it’s not dropping too much. (Ideally, you would take in slower acting carbohydrates … things that are lower on the Glycemic Index table of foods, as these take longer to break down into their residual components. i.e. the glucose that affects the way you feel.)
